(22 Dec 2008) HEADLINE: Family claims Iraqi shoe thrower was tortured
CAPTION: The Iraqi journalist who threw his shoes at President George W. Bush says he would do it again and that he was forced to write a letter of apology after being tortured in jail, the journalist's brother claimed Monday. (Dec. 22)

THE IRAQI JOURNALIST WHO THREW HIS SHOES AT PRESIDENT BUSH WROTE A LETTER OF APOLOGY AND ASKED FOR A PARDON LAST WEEK. HIS BROTHER NOW SAYS MUNTADHAR AL-ZEIDI'S WAS TORTURED IN JAIL AND FORCED TO WRITE THE LETTER.

UDAY AL-ZEIDI'S SAYS HIS BROTHER HAS NO REGRETS AND WOULD DO IT ALL OVER AGAIN. THOUSANDS OF IRAQIS HAVE RALLIED TO DEMAND HIS RELEASE. THE REPORTER'S NEWS CONFERENCE OUTBURST HAS BEEN REPEATEDLY BROADCAST AROUND THE WORLD -- MAKING MUNTADHAR AL-ZEIDI'S A SYMBOL OPPONENTS OF THE U.S.-LED INVASION AND OCCUPATION OF IRAQ.
LAST WEEK A JUDGE IN THE CASE ACKNOWLEDGED THAT AL-ZEIDI'S FACE WAS BEATEN. UDAY AL-ZEIDI SAYS HE SAW MORE-SEVERE INJURIES DURING A JAIL VISIT-- INCLUDING A MISSING TOOTH AND CIGARETTE BURNS ON HIS BROTHER'S EARS. AN IRAQI COURT OFFICIAL SAYS THE JOURNALIST DIDN'T ASK THE JUDGE FOR A DOCTOR OR MAKE ANY TORTURE ALLEGATIONS.
NEITHER BUSH NOR IRAQI PRIME MINISTER AL-MALIKI ARE SEEKING CHARGES, BUT THE JUDGE SAYS HE CANNOT LEGALLY DROP THE CHARGES. IF CONVICTED AL-ZEIDI COULD SPEND TWO YEARS IN JAIL FOR INSULTING A FOREIGN LEADER.
UDAY SAYS HIS BROTHER'S TRIAL IS SCHEDULED TO BEGIN ON DECEMBER 31ST.

3. SOUNDBITE (Arabic) Uday al-Zeidi, Muntadhar al-Zeidi's brother:
"When I met Muntadhar yesterday, I saw signs of torture on his face, body and his limbs. I asked him 'how did this happen?' He said 'they first beat me with an iron bar when I first came out of the news conference room'. He said he was screaming and they must have heard his voice. So they used the iron bar."

5. SOUNDBITE (Arabic) Uday al-Zeidi, Muntadhar al-Zeidi's brother:
"Muntadhar filed a lawsuit and authorised me to file a suit against the correspondent who beat him up, the correspondent of Kurd Sat. It was the duty of the security people to protect Muntadhar al-Zeidi. So a lawsuit has been filed against al-Maliki's security detail, and we will file another lawsuit against Hussein, the Kurd Sat correspondent."
